Zobrazeno 1 - 10
of 24
pro vyhledávání: '"David Alex Lamb"'
Publikováno v:
Requirements Engineering. 4:19-37
This paper introduces the idea of a software behavioural view: intuitively, this is a complete description of the behaviour of the system observable from a specific point of view. We believe that a fully developed methodology based on views would sig
Autor:
David Alex Lamb, Xiaobao Yu
Publikováno v:
Annals of Software Engineering. 1:23-41
Applying metrics to software is a way to measure and improve software quality. Many metrics apply to software implementations (code), so they cannot be used early in the life cycle. We survey ten modularity and structural complexity metrics applicabl
Autor:
David Alex Lamb
Publikováno v:
Tyndale Bulletin. 63
1. The Rise and Fall of a Paradigm? The Johannine Community in Recent Scholarship 2. The Community of the Beloved Disciple: The Development of Raymond Brown's Model of Community 3. Text and Context: The Contribution of Sociolinguistic Theories of Reg
Publikováno v:
IEEE Transactions on Software Engineering. 20:631-643
How should iterators be abstracted and encapsulated in modern imperative languages? We consider the combined impact of several factors on this question: the need for a common interface model for user defined iterator abstractions, the importance of f
Autor:
David Alex Lamb
Publikováno v:
IEEE Transactions on Software Engineering. 16:1352-1360
Iterators are defined, and previously published methods for defining their meanings are outlined. It is shown how to use trace specifications to define a common form of iterator module (Alphard-style iterators). A form of specification for an iterato
Autor:
David Alex Lamb
Publikováno v:
Software Engineering Education ISBN: 0387970908
CSEE
CSEE
This position paper proposes questions to consider in planning curricula for undergraduate software engineering education. We should specify the audience for such curricula, plan a process for deciding what material to incorporate and how to keep it
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::badf73bf2d05ff7ee502dc6f112adb4e
https://doi.org/10.1007/bfb0042368
https://doi.org/10.1007/bfb0042368
Autor:
David Alex Lamb
Publikováno v:
Software Engineering Education ISBN: 0387968547
CSEE
CSEE
Software engineering project courses are highly valuable to students, but often require far too much work. This report discusses some methods for reducing the workload for students of such courses while retaining the important benefits.
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::9a64e745cf06dbf9fe1e37a4c049930a
https://doi.org/10.1007/bfb0043596
https://doi.org/10.1007/bfb0043596
Publikováno v:
Proceedings of the 4th International Workshop on Parallel and Distributed Real-Time Systems.
The paper introduces a formalism called Viewcharts, for specification and composition of software behavioral views. The objective is software behavioral requirements specification independent of implementation. The paper claims that behavioral requir
Autor:
David Alex Lamb, Hosein Isazadeh
Publikováno v:
Systems Development Methods for the Next Century ISBN: 9781461377122
CASE tools are large, complex, very labour-intensive, and costly to produce and adopt. They provide much less than they promised, and what they provide is not easily usable. A study of this problem reveals that supported methodologies play key roles.
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::795b78aec09453fb1356a129d9604035
https://doi.org/10.1007/978-1-4615-5915-3_25
https://doi.org/10.1007/978-1-4615-5915-3_25
Autor:
David Alex Lamb
Publikováno v:
Lecture Notes in Computer Science ISBN: 9783540612858
ICSE Workshop on Studies of Software Design
ICSE Workshop on Studies of Software Design
Externí odkaz:
https://explore.openaire.eu/search/publication?articleId=doi_________::8201819c787ec33c2f35e2028e8b29ae
https://doi.org/10.1007/bfb0030514
https://doi.org/10.1007/bfb0030514